How it went

I had plenty of problems trying to achieve this. My starting goal was far too ambitious. I decided I was going to use supabase as a means to permanently save Spotify data to not make a request twice. I soon learned the time to do this was way too long for the user experience, so I had to ditch the plans for an external database.

I then tried keeping up the same database of requested data locally, but it too proved to be a bad idea. Timing was still not at its best and the memory used by the app was also very high.

I finally, after a couple of weeks , had to resort to using a static database for items first loading into the website; that is, the personal library in the navbar and the items in the homepage.

As for the front end, I strived to be as close as possible to the real thing. However I still had a difficult time with a couple of things such a dragging elements like the navbar and the volume and play bar. They do work as of now, but I could implement more improvements in the near future.
